For the first 65 laps of Monday’s rain-postponed Goody’s Fast Pain Relief 500 NASCAR Sprint Cup Series race at Martinsville (Va.) Speedway, it appeared as though Tony Stewart had a great chance for his third career victory at the .526-mile oval. Unfortunately, the handling on Stewart’s No. 14 Old Spice/Office Depot Chevrolet Impala became problematic, making for a long day for Stewart and crew chief Darian Grubb and relegating them to a disappointing 26th-place finish. TONY STEWART met with media on Friday and discussed the new spoiler, racing at Martinsville, Jimmie Johnson’s popularity, his involvement in Ryan Newman’s team, and more.
TALK ABOUT HOW PRACTICE WENT FOR YOU TODAY: “It was good. We started in race trim and basically the last 20 minutes in qualifying trim. Car is driving pretty good so far.” Continue reading Tony Stewart Friday Media Visit
